This document explains how usage is calculated inside the AI Agent.
All pricing is based on credits, and every credit corresponds to one tool call.
The Agent works by calling different internal tools to complete a user’s request. Each tool performs one action — like querying data, generating a visualization, or searching the web.

You can track and audit your usage at any time in the Settings → Usage section of the platform. This dashboard shows how many credits have been consumed, broken down by date range, tool type, and workspace.
For each workspace, you’ll see visual charts that reflect how usage is trending over time. You can also identify which users are generating the most tool calls, and which types of prompts are driving credit consumption.
The AI Agent’s usage model is simple: every tool call equals one credit. Most real-world questions involve multiple steps — querying data, transforming it, visualizing it, or enriching it with external context — and typically consume between 3 and 5 credits.
